Is it true that every participant in the Crete operation received an EK II (and if he already had one, he received the EK I)? If so, are the requirements known (ie, had to set foot on Cretan soil during a certain time period)?

Jason, i.m.o. not true.

It has been mentionned before that the same applied for the FJ's in Holland, which turned out to be incorrect. It is however mentionned too that jumping while under enemy-fire ("hot LZ") was worth an EKII, but I heaven't seen any prove of that untill now. As for f.e. Korinth there is a small paper you should have on which is written who should be awarded with an EK II or EK I and most FJ there also jumped "under fire". The list only mentions about 15 names if I remember correctly.

I do have copies of papers from the FJ-Sanitätsabteilung in which an officer mentionned people who should be rewarded an EK and why. So every man an EK II ?? I think not.

I don't know about everyone but there does seem to be a very large amount of Crete based EK's for not just FJ's but also Gebirgsjäger. I have seen quite a few Crete related citation sets and Soldbucher/Wehrpasse for the paras and they usually include at least one EK award dated for Crete. And I myself have a Wehrpass to a member of Luftlande Sturm Rgt 1 and a Soldbuch to a member of Fallschirm-Panzerjäger-Abt 7 who were both at Crete and both awarded EK's, as was a member of GJR 100 who I have a Soldbuch to.
I'd be interested if anyone knows the percentage of those involved who won at least one of the EK grades for Crete.
